Tyrrelstown 3: 204 all out (M.Hodgson 3-55, A.Surve 4-22).
Halverstown 1: 92 all out (Z.Mohyuddin 19*).
Tyrrelstown 3 win by 112 runs
Having lost the toss, Halverstown were predictably made to bowl first on a very warm day and playing for the first time on a new look HCC Oval outfield. What a difference a close cut of the grass makes, or perhaps no cloud cover, a pink ball that loses its sheen after the first 8 overs and attacking batting. Tyrreltstown raced to 150-2 after 20 overs and a score in excess of 320+ seemed very probable with both batsman well set having each made rapid unbeaten 50s. At this level of cricket the drinks break more often than not breaks the concentration flow and so it proved in spectacular fashion. Matt swiftly removed both set batsman paving the way for the collapse to begin in earnest. Tyrellstown losing their last 8 wickets for the addition of only 30 runs. Atul once again weaving his magic to take another 4’fer, with Vishnu cleaning up the tail at the other end with some hostile, accurate deliveries.
The Halverstown response was disappointing and saw the hard work done by the bowlers end up in vain. Having slipped to 26-5, Halverstown succumbed to 92 all out with only Zia (19*) providing any sort of resistance. This was a rare off day where the batting didn’t fire with the game for the taking. Nevertheless there are positives to take away from this game, particularly with the way we regained control of the game during their innings as well as the bowling form of some of our players which is already looking on point.
